Rebuildr Runbook — Account Recovery (for weekly eng sync)

When the incremental rebuild bot loses its publishing credentials, partial deploys may strand stale pages. First verify the content hash index is intact, then re-register the bot through the Fennimore recovery portal. The portal will challenge for the maintainer passphrase before reissuing tokens. The current passphrase appears on the line below.

vault phrase of tajeg-tageg = pelix-druix-holius-briael-zorwyn-frawyn-fraox-norok-drueth-aldiel

# Basement Archive Room — Night Access

The archive room under Pellworth House holds old contracts and the tape backups. Night shift: take stairwell C, not the lift (it's switched off after midnight). Lights are on a timer by the door — slap the button as you go in. Sign the logbook, even at 3am, yes really. The keypad by the door takes the code below.

staff pass of fahap-tajeg = bdg-FT-6

**Account Recovery: Date Format Gotchas**

When verifying a Brightmoor customer's identity, remember their birthdate shows in the locale of their original signup, not their current one. So a Kellanport user might see 03/07 meaning July 3rd. Double-check before rejecting a mismatch — we've locked out legit folks over this. Once verified, unlock the account using the team passphrase below.

unlock words, hahip-baduf: holwyn-istath-julvan

### Step 6: Repoint the partner SFTP drop

Future maintainers: the nightly drop from Kestrel Logistics moves from the old ingest host to the new Fennelgate transfer service. Files land in a staging directory, are checksummed, then promoted; partial uploads are ignored until a matching marker file arrives. Keep the old host read-only for two weeks in case Kestrel's side lags. After the DNS change propagates, start the transfer service with the configuration below.

service settings:
[casax]
port = 6379
team = rusir
host = casax.zemvarhq.corp
region = outer-4
access_code = ac_9808ce
timeout_ms = 1500